But, in honor of The Rotary Foundation’s 100th Anniversary, we want you to also consider leaving a permanent legacy by becoming a Bequest Society member.  The neat thing is that it does not require that you send in any money now.
 
Join with fellow club members past and present who have remember The Rotary Foundation’ Endowment Fund in their estate plans.  The principal of the gift is never spent, so a portion of the earnings will always be available for Foundation programs. 
The Rotary Foundation is known for its commitment to effective programs that make a real difference in people’s lives.  A gift from your estate to the Endowment Fund can provide ongoing financial support for one or more Rotary service areas, as if you were continuing to make annual contributions in perpetuity.
